This lecture explores the journey of a well-known researcher in the field of education policy. The speaker takes us take us on a journey from her beginnings as a Brazilian practitioner who meets South-South cooperation and policy transfer, to her PhD research on the transfer of a literacy program from Brazil to Mozambique, and her subsequent work tracing the global trajectory of a policy model. This exploration opened doors to a new and exciting research agenda.
